Try setting your Pymol viewer to square dimensions first:

Viewport 600,600

Then try the ray command

This should work

Subject: [PyMOL] Question about ray

Dear Pymol-Users,

I tried to ray my protein to get a good looking picture. I tried set  
ray_trace_mode, 0 and ray 1200, 1200. I always go a square around my  
protein and parts where not visible.
How can I get rid of that black border line and how can I ray my  
protein so it is on the whole page visible and not in a box cut off.
